Raymond Woo Sells 8,087 Shares of CeriBell (NASDAQ:CBLL) Stock

Key Points

  • Raymond Woo sold 8,087 shares of CeriBell on March 2 at an average price of $18.25 for $147,587.75, reducing his holdings to 166,912 shares (a 4.62% cut) after additional sales in January and February.
  • CeriBell beat the quarter's estimates, reporting a ($0.36) loss per share versus a ($0.43) consensus and $24.78 million in revenue, though the company still shows negative margins and return on equity.
  • Analyst sentiment is mildly bullish—MarketBeat shows an average rating of "Moderate Buy" with an average price target of $24.67, while the stock trades near $17.96 within a 52-week range of $10.01–$24.33.

CeriBell, Inc. (NASDAQ:CBLL - Get Free Report) CTO Raymond Woo sold 8,087 shares of CeriBell stock in a transaction dated Monday, March 2nd. The stock was sold at an average price of $18.25, for a total transaction of $147,587.75. Following the transaction, the chief technology officer owned 166,912 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$3,046,144. The trade was a 4.62%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through this link.

Raymond Woo also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Monday, February 23rd, Raymond Woo sold 705 shares of CeriBell st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$19.79, for a total value of $13,951.95.
  • On Friday, January 2nd, Raymond Woo sold 11,112 shares of CeriBell st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$21.18, for a total value of $235,352.16.

CeriBell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:CBLL traded up $0.19 on Thursday, hitting $17.96. The company had a trading volume of 63,397 shares, compared to its average volume of 343,432. The company has a market cap of $676.03 million, a PE ratio of -12.22 and a beta of 1.12. The business has a 50 day moving average of $20.91 and a 200 day moving average of $16.41. CeriBell, Inc. has a 52-week low of $10.01 and a 52-week high of $24.33. The company has a current ratio of 9.73, a quick ratio of 9.35 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.13.




CeriBell (NASDAQ:CBLL -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, February 24th. The company reported ($0.36) ear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.43) by $0.07. CeriBell had a negative net margin of 59.97% and a negative return on equity of 31.77%. The firm had revenue of $24.78 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$23.95 million. As a group, equities analysts anticipate that CeriBell, Inc. will post -2.46 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
